Long considered a literary heir of Dashiell Hammett and Raymond Chandler, Ross Macdonald (1915–83) infused new life into the hardboiled detective genre with psychologically complex mysteries involving his intuitive and empathetic private eye Lew Archer. This omnibus presents three of Macdonald's best Archer novels. The Ivory Grin (a.k.a. Marked for Murder) begins when a wealthy woman hires Archer to track down a maid she suspects of stealing her jewelry. The Zebra-Striped Hearse finds Archer investigating a rich man's prospective son-in-law, and in The Underground Man Archer tracks a missing child and uncovers a secret history of wayward parents and wounded offspring.

Exquisitely produced — bound in sandalwood linen and presented in a matching linen case with a button-tie closure and stamped Chinese yin mark — this album offers a vivid impression of pre-World War II China. Stanley Gamble, the grandson of the co-founder of Proctor & Gamble, took three extended journeys through China from 1917 to 1932. His surveys of life in Beijing and rural northern China included the remarkable photographs reproduced here, paired with Chinese poetry.

Celebrated in the wake of the 1917 Russian Revolution but later repressed by the Stalinist regime, Ukrainian artist Kazimir Malevich was an inventive artist who experimented with various Post-Impressionist styles like cubism and fauvism before abandoning representational art altogether, creating a style of geometric shapes and blocks of color that he called «Suprematism». Now recognized as one of the great photographers of the 19th century, British army officer Linnaeus Tripe (1822–1902) captured superb images of antiquities, temples, palaces, and landscapes in India and Burma in the 1850s. Informal, candid, and decidedly modern, «street photography» has often been associated with Paris and New York City, but Moscow has a long tradition of it as well. With 34 black and white photographs by such photographers as Aleksandr Rodchenko, Vladimir Kupriyanov, and Anatolii Boldin, these images span the 20th century. The photos depict a diverse nation that has always been nonconformist at heart: a woman in a bonnet carefully handles a munitions shell in a factory; a comically disheveled shoe shiner smokes a cigarette in front of his shop; and a model stands on a rooftop, draped in the Soviet flag.

The author of such novels as The Portrait of a Lady and The Wings of the Dove, Henry James was also a devotee of the novella, and in this omnibus literary critic Philip Rahv has collected ten of James's most important short novels. Accompanied by Rahv's commentary, this collection contains Madame de Mauves, Daisy Miller, An International Episode, The Siege of London, Lady Barberina, The Author of Beltraffio, The Aspern Papers, The Pupil, The Turn of the Screw, and The Beast in the Jungle.

He considered himself «in the very first row of the second-raters, « yet Somerset Maugham was one of the most successful and influential writers of the 20th century, praised by authors like Anthony Burgess, Ian Fleming, and George Orwell, who called Maugham «the modern writer who has influenced me the most ... for his power of telling a story straightforwardly and without frills.» This omnibus contains three novels-Liza of Lambeth (1897), which enabled Maugham to become a full-time writer; The Magician (1908), a caricature of Aleister Crowley; and The Moon and Sixpence (1919), loosely based on the life of Paul Gauguin-as well as five stories, including «Rain, « about the redemption of prostitute Sadie Thompson.

As this 1989 thriller begins, James Bond has lost his license to kill. After he took revenge on the CIA agent who handed his friend over to the master criminal Sanchez, M revoked Bond's double-0 status. Now considered a rogue agent, with MI6 trying to bring him in and only the support of Q behind him, Bond goes after Sanchez. Aboard a ship, Bond tricks his way into Sanchez's inner circle and discovers the secret of his wealth—but Bond is walking a tightrope, and it is only a matter of time before he slips. After Kingsley Amis wrote Colonel Sun in 1968, it was John Gardner who was asked to carry on writing new adventures starring James Bond. Gardner ultimately wrote 14 original Bond books (as did Bond's creator, Ian Fleming), plus novelizations of the films GoldenEye and License to Kill.

Major Richard Sharpe awaits the opening shots of the army's Vitoria campaign with grim expectancy in this 17th book of his chronicles, from 1985. Victory depends on the increasingly fragile alliance between Britain and Spain-an alliance that must be maintained at any cost. But Sharpe's enemy Pierre Ducos seizes a chance to both destroy the alliance and take a personal revenge on Sharpe. And when the lovely spy, La Marquesa, takes a hand in the game, Sharpe finds himself caught in a web of deadly intrigue and becomes a fugitive, hunted by enemy and ally alike. Bernard Cornwell grew up with the Hornblower novels, following C.S. Forester's fictional hero through Lord Nelson's navy during the Napoleonic wars, and created his army counterpart in Richard Sharpe, a rifleman in Lord Wellington's land campaign. Cornwell has produced 24 novels and stories in the series, which traces Sharpe's career from 1799 and the Siege of Seringapatam in India to an encounter with the exiled Napoleon himself in 1821, and inspired the British television series Sharpe, starring Sean Bean.

(Part of the original Foundation Trilogy, winner of the Hugo Award for Best All-Time Novel Series) This is the first novel in Isaac Asimov's Foundation saga, originally a three-part masterwork-for which a special Hugo Award was created, Best All-Time Novel Series, recognizing its status as a central work of science fiction-that was later expanded to a seven-part series. Foundation describes a far future in which humanity numbers in the quadrillions, spread across millions of worlds, governed by the vast and presumably eternal Empire. But genius mathematician Hari Seldon-who has developed the study of psychohistory, or the dynamics of very large numbers of humans-has predicted the Empire's certain downfall. In order to mitigate the chaos that would follow, he proposes that a Foundation of all human knowledge be built at the edge of the galaxy.
